Community Facilities Grant Program (Deadline for Applications - Contact USDA State office) The purpose of the Community Facilities Grant Program is to assist in the development of essential community facilities in rural areas and towns of up to 20,000 in population. Grant funds can be used to construct, enlarge, or improve community facilities for health care, public safety, and community and public services. | Small Research Grant to Improve Health Care Quality through Health Information Technology (IT) (R03) (Deadline: Nov. 16, 2011) The purpose of this grant is to support a wide variety of research designs in order to improve the quality, safety, effectiveness, and efficiency of health care through the implementation and use of health IT. | Exploratory and Developmental Grant to Improve Health Care Quality through Health Information Technology (IT) (R21) (Deadline: Nov. 16, 2011) The purpose of this grant is to support short-term preparatory studies that will inform real world health IT implementation and use the conduct of more comprehensive health IT implementation research. |
